Miguel Zapata (Zapa) comes from A Coruña, Northern Spain. Former member of The Highlights, the spanish Bob Dylan tribute band, with which he toured intensively in 2006 when he was only 17. He started writing his own music soon after leaving the band, recording in 2007 his first demo, “Five Songs Left”. His songs, delicate and introspective, are highly influenced by the psychedelic sounds of the 60s offering “a lovely delivery of lyrics, and a softly psychedelic style that is perfect chill-out soundtrack.” (Marilyn Roxie, ‘A Future in Noise’)
His particular style would attract the attention of Donovan himself, a legend of the 60s and one of Zapa’s biggest influences, who invited him to a three-day meeting in Artá, Mallorca.
A free compilation, “Songs 2006-2009”, was released by the San Francisco-based label Vulpiano Records in 2009, and includes the best songs from his demos “Five Songs Left” and “Home Recordings”.
He lives in London where he's currently working on his first major album. He also performs as a DJ in 1960s parties and illustrates flyers and posters for concerts.
